Smart Bed Market: Definition/ Overview
A smart bed is an advanced style of bed that incorporates technology to improve sleep quality and overall comfort. Unlike ordinary beds, smart beds are outfitted with sensors and connectivity features that monitor many elements of sleep including body movements, heart rate, breathing patterns, and even sleep cycles. These mattresses use the data gathered to provide insights into the user's sleeping habits and make real-time adjustments to improve comfort.
Smart mattresses are transforming the way people approach sleep and health management with uses that go far beyond ordinary comfort. These mattresses are outfitted with innovative sensors and technologies that track a variety of health parameters such as heart rate, breathing patterns, and sleep cycles. Smart beds can deliver individualized sleep suggestions based on this data allowing users to improve their sleep quality.
Smart beds are likely to incorporate even more sophisticated technologies cementing their place at the forefront of the connected health and wellness movement. For example, as artificial intelligence and machine learning improve, smart beds are anticipated to provide even more precise and predictive insights regarding sleep patterns and overall health.
The growing use of smart home technology is a crucial driver for the smart bed market. As customers embrace connected gadgets and seek to improve their living spaces with intelligent solutions, smart beds are becoming an essential component of the modern, tech-enabled home ecosystem. The increasing growth of the smart home market is driving the smart bed industry ahead. According to the United States Census Bureau's American Housing Survey, the percentage of houses having smart devices climbed from 7.2% in 2015 to 13.2% in 2019, indicating an increasing trend toward home automation.
This trend is reinforced by data from the Consumer Technology Association which predicts that smart home gadget sales in the United States will reach USD 44 Billion by 2023, up from $29 billion in 2019. Furthermore, the US Department of Energy believes that smart home technologies can lower home energy consumption by up to 10%, which includes smart beds with energy-saving capabilities.
The high initial costs and maintenance needs may offer substantial barriers to the broad adoption of smart beds, thereby impeding market growth. Smart beds which include advanced capabilities such as sleep tracking, automatic modifications, and integrated health monitoring are typically prohibitively expensive making them less accessible to a wide range of consumers. This cost barrier is especially important in markets where consumers are price-sensitive or where the perceived value of smart beds has not yet justified the expenditure.
Furthermore, the intricacy of smart bed systems raises questions regarding their long-term stability and longevity. Smart beds, like any other technology-intensive product, require regular maintenance to ensure optimal performance. This may include diagnosing software issues, updating firmware, or fixing hardware failures. Furthermore, the necessity for specialist support, as well as the potential difficulty in locating skilled experts may increase these concerns.
Hospitals hold the largest market share for smart beds and are expected to have the highest comp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 5.66% over the forecast period. This expansion is primarily driven by the growing use of Internet of Things (IoT) technology in healthcare settings. Smart beds outfitted with advanced sensors and networking features are becoming increasingly important in hospitals for monitoring patient health boosting comfort, and improving treatment efficiency.
The residential sector was the second-largest market for smart beds although not at the same rate as the hospital sector. Residential smart bed applications are growing in popularity due to increased awareness of sleep health and the desire for new sleep solutions. Investments in sleep technology aimed at increasing individual well-being and overall sleep quality are driving the sector's growth. As more people seek tailored sleep experiences and incorporate smart technology into their homes, the residential market for smart beds is likely to expand.
Automatic smart beds are the dominant sector. This dominance is primarily driven by rising consumer demand for the convenience and enhanced features that autonomous beds provide. Automatic smart beds have high-tech features including changeable positions, integrated sleep tracking, climate control, and smart home networking. These features address the increased desire for individualized comfort and improved sleep quality.
Furthermore, technological developments and lower prices for smart components have made automatic smart beds more accessible to a larger audience. Voice control, automated sleep pattern correction, and connectivity with other smart home devices have all contributed to the popularity of automatic smart beds. As the market grows, people are increasingly selecting for beds that provide a higher level of convenience and customization leading to the domination of the automatic category.
The smart bed market in North America is primarily driven by the region's strong smartphone adoption. This trend is led by the United States where smartphone penetration is at an all-time high creating an ecosystem suitable for smart home technology integration.
According to the United States Census Bureau, approximately 92% of households will have at least one smartphone in 2021, indicating a near-ubiquitous presence of devices capable of interfacing with smart home technology such as smart beds.
The integration of smart beds into other smart home ecosystems is accelerating market growth. According to the National Sleep Foundation, 65% of Americans believe technology will improve their sleep quality demonstrating a willingness to adopt smart bed technologies. Furthermore, the United States Department of Health and Human Services emphasizes the importance of sleep health stating that insufficient sleep affects 50-70 million Americans.
The Asia-Pacific region is undergoing significant digital transformation with smart homes emerging as one of the fastest-growing categories. This digital transformation is a major driver of the smart bed market as customers demand more technologically advanced and linked sleep solutions. According to International Data Corporation (IDC), the Asia Pacific smart home device market is predicted to develop at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 21.5% between 2022 and 2026, reaching 600 million units by 2026. The significant development in smart home adoption has a direct impact on the smart bed market.
Another important element boosting the Asia Pacific smart bed market is the digital transformation of the healthcare industry. The COVID-19 epidemic has expedited the use of digital health technologies such as smart beds in hospitals and home care settings. For example, the Indian government's National Digital Health Mission, which began in 2020 intends to establish a digital health ecosystem, potentially increasing the usage of smart healthcare technologies such as smart beds.
